In a context where trust, humanisation and efficiency are fundamental pillars, pharmacy design must go beyond simple functionality. Today, it plays an essential role in communicating the identity and values of the brand. A pharmacy is no longer just a place for dispensing medication. It is also a space for guidance, emotional connection, and health experience. In this setting, spatial storytelling emerges as a highly effective strategy for differentiation — because a well-designed environment not only meets functional and regulatory requirements but also conveys a clear, empathetic and memorable narrative.
